Beads, Braids And Brides Poem by Maureen Alikor

Beads, Braids And Brides



Give me my braids,
make me purple beads
watch me blink my eyelids
as I follow your leads.

Give me more braids,
and see newly wed brides
hide behind the curtain blinds
when they see our minds.

Give me braided beads
tie them around my waist
as I wriggle to the dance tunes you play.

Give me more beads,
let them grace my ankles
as I step into our castle of love.

Give me beads.
Give me braids.
I am your bride
And yours alone to tend.
